Searching a word with underscores in Smart Search doesn't search for the exact phrase

Post by simbian » Mon Feb 06, 2023 8:51 am

Hello, before upgrading to latest Joomla 4.x stable i was using com_search component in Joomla 3.10.x and for example if i search for the word MAN_1_4_1 it exactly gives me the results for the whole word.
In Joomla 4.x i switched to Smart Search component and if i search for the same word it gives me results for MAN and 1 and 4 and 1. How i can search for the exact phrase?

Just done a test
* Created Test Article with text ... man_1_4_1
* Created Test Article 2 with text ... man
* Created Menu item for smart search

Tested with and without search filter created in Smart search

Results using search box
smart search 01.JPG
Results using search from menu item (also auto adds to search box)
smart search 02.JPG
Both only show one result not the result for the test 2 that had the word 'man'
